Default How do I figure yardage for bias binding

I did a search here for bias binding and watched both videos but neither one said how much or how big of a piece of fabric you need to make the binding. The Quilted Patch looked like she used a length the same as the width (45") but I don't want to waste that much fabric to cut strips for a 70" square quilt. I cut my binding at 2 1/4" and if I was doing straight binding I would only need about 1/2 yard.
